In order to implement this, we'll have to live with some ambiguity, or move to using ordered dicts everywhere. Consider this TOML file.
# This is my TOML file
[mytable]
# My table is great
# Make it greater
greater = true
greatest = true # Make it the greatest
There are, sort of, two types of comments. Inline comments that appear in the same line as a line of code, and full-line comments that simply appear near their code.
Because the tables are unordered, and the order may change when dumping the tables, the "best" way to preserve the comments is to relate them to a line of configuration. Inline comments are simple to do this way: just attach them to whatever was on the line with them. Whole line or multi-line comments are ambiguous, though, as they may better attach to the parent scope, or to the following configuration. Without preserving even more of the file, especially the ordering, there's not a great way to deal with this ambiguity.
We can make a choice about which is the Right Way for whole-line comments to be considered, but I'm not sure which way it is. I think I'd be inclined toward it being associated with the following item if it exists, otherwise with the parent scope.This association is guaranteed to be wrong some of the time, though, without a good solution. The only real fix for that is to make it not matter whether we get it right or not, by making sure that the keys end up staying where they need to.
So, my initial reaction (per my earlier response in this issue) is that preserving comment information is overkill for almost all users of load
/loads
. For that reason, I don't think that load
/loads
should preserve comment information (at least, not by default, and not via a boolean flag).
However, after looking at kennethreitz/pipenv#212, and what pipenv does to some TOML files, I think that there should be a facility in the library to allow its users to easily preserve comment information (or other information about a given piece of TOML).
ConfigObj
is a project that provides comment-preserving editing of INI-files (unlike the standard library's configparser
module), so that may provide some useful inspiration for adding a comment-preserving editing mode here: https://github.com/DiffSK/configobj/blob/master/src/configobj/init.py
However, I agree that it makes sense for comment-preserving to be an opt-in behaviour - it's only needed when tools want to support automated editing of the config file, and that's the exception rather than the rule.
